The Development Bank of Nigeria (DBN) was conceived by the Federal Government of Nigeria (FGN) in collaboration with global development partners to address the major financing challenges facing Micro, Small and Medium Scale Enterprises (MSMEs) in Nigeria.

Job Title: Legal Officer

Location: Nigeria

Job Objective and Summary

  • The Legal Officer provides effective legal services and compliance advice to the institution (including its subsidiary) in the most efficient manner.
  • He/She provides support in the delivery of corporate governance and regulatory compliance responsibilities.
  • The role reports to the Company Secretary/Legal Adviser.

Core Responsibilities
Provision of Legal Advice:

  • Provides assistance in the management of relationship with specialist external legal firms and practitioners, as required.
  • Transfers files to external lawyers and monitors performance.
  • Reviews and ensures updates to the Bank’s documents as needed.
  • Participates in collaboration with the Legal Adviser, legislative and regulatory changes or developments that might affect the institution’s operations or Board activities, and ensures briefing of the Board to aid informed decisions.
  • Analyses formal complaints against the Bank/its subsidiary and provides advice on measures of action.
  • Ensures that proper legal consultations are provided to departments / units.
  • Conducts review on texts of standard contracts, agreements and forms.
  • Assists with the registration of agreements for submission to ministries, governmental departments, relevant administrations and agencies.
  • Prepares Memorandum of Understanding, bills and statutes on administrative matters and conduct research on appropriate emerging legal issues.
  • Meetings and Representation
  • Provides representation to the Bank in ensuring the efficient handling and winning resolution of all negotiations and disputes.
  • Participates in meetings with clients and concerned parties to discuss related legal matters.

Qualifications
Educational Qualifications:

  • A Bachelor’s Degree in Law
  • Possession of a Post graduate qualification (i.e. LLM) is an added advantage

Experience:

  • Minimum of 3 years post call cognate experience in a financial regulatory environment is required.

Professional Qualifications:

  • Membership of the Nigerian Bar Association is required.

Competencies:
Knowledge:

  • Understanding of legal issues including governance and legal compliance
  • Understanding of the financial services industry policies and principles/p>
  • Knowledge of customer service principles and practices
  • Knowledge of conflict management
  • Knowledge of administrative laws
  • Understanding of ethical rules and laws.

Technical Competencies:

  • Demonstrates expertise in negotiation, arbitration and contracts
  • Demonstrates expertise in providing advice at Board/Top Management level
  • Demonstrates expertise in dispute resolution
  • Expertise in the application of principles and instruments of Company Law
  • Excellent communication skills (Oral & Written).

Behavioural Competencies:

  • Problem-solving/decision making ability
  • Creativity
  • Ability to perform multiple tasks
  • Teamwork, collaboration and networking skills
  • Accuracy and attention to details.
